Anastase Titanium Dioxide DECACHIMIE S.A. Anastase Titanium Dioxide is the naturally occurring oxide of titanium, chemical formula TiO 2. When used as a pigment, it is called titanium white. Generally it is sourced from ilmenite, rutile and anatase. It has a wide range of applications, from paint...展开 Anastase Titanium Dioxide is the naturally occurring oxide of titanium, chemical formula TiO 2. When used as a pigment, it is called titanium white. Generally it is sourced from ilmenite, rutile and anatase. It has a wide range of applications, from paint to sunscreen to food colouring. When used as a food colouring, it has E number E171. Titanium dioxide is the most widely used white pigment because of its brightness and very high refractive index, in which it is surpassed only by a few other materials. 收起
Saccharin Soda DECACHIMIE S.A. Saccharin Soda is an artificial sweetener. The basic substance, benzoic sulfilimine, has effectively no food energy and is much sweeter than sucrose, but has a bitter or metallic aftertaste, especially at high concentrations. It is used to sweeten product...展开 Saccharin Soda is an artificial sweetener. The basic substance, benzoic sulfilimine, has effectively no food energy and is much sweeter than sucrose, but has a bitter or metallic aftertaste, especially at high concentrations. It is used to sweeten products such as drinks, candies, cookies, medicines, and toothpaste. Saccharin derives its name from the word "saccharine", meaning of, relating to, or resembling sugar. Saccharin is unstable when heated but it does not react chemically with other food ingredients. 收起

Tartaric acid Natural L + DECACHIMIE S.A. Tartaric acid is a white crystalline diprotic aldaric acid. It occurs naturally in many plants, particularly grapes, bananas, and tamarinds, is commonly combined with baking soda to function as a leavening agent in recipes, and is one of the main acids fo...展开 Tartaric acid is a white crystalline diprotic aldaric acid. It occurs naturally in many plants, particularly grapes, bananas, and tamarinds, is commonly combined with baking soda to function as a leavening agent in recipes, and is one of the main acids found in wine. It is added to other foods to give a sour taste, and is used as an antioxidant. Salts of tartaric acid are known as tartrates. It is a dihydroxyl derivative of succinic acid. 收起
Vanillin DECACHIMIE S.A. Vanillin is an organic compound who's functional groups include aldehyde, hydroxyl, and ether. It is the primary component of the extract of the vanilla bean. Synthetic vanillin, instead of natural vanilla extract, is now more often used as a flavoring ag...展开 Vanillin is an organic compound who's functional groups include aldehyde, hydroxyl, and ether. It is the primary component of the extract of the vanilla bean. Synthetic vanillin, instead of natural vanilla extract, is now more often used as a flavoring agent in foods, beverages, and pharmaceuticals. Natural "vanilla extract" is a mixture of several hundred different compounds in addition to vanillin. Artificial vanilla flavoring is often a solution of pure vanillin, usually of synthetic origin. Because of the scarcity and expense of natural vanilla extract, there has long been interest in the synthetic preparation of its predominant component. 收起
